Important Notes

Prospective buyers of coloured gemstones should be aware that some stones might have been treated to enhance their colour or clarity. Sapphires and rubies are commonly heat-treated and emeralds are commonly oiled. In the case of heat treatment, this is permanent but can affect the durability of the stones. In the case of oiling, this may need to be redone after a period of years. The international jewellery trade has generally accepted these methods. It is not possible for Bearnes Hampton & Littlewood to obtain gemmological reports on stones offered for sale and so prospective buyers should assume all gemstones have been enhanced by some method.

Weights and measurements are approximate guidelines only, unless otherwise stated to the contrary.
